Output e24ca68d08d1d02dc3120d31f24cbdb59eb0b1f6357434dd7539f3aed906e9e4:24

value
83785000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9e60fea6f16fa4da5df391c5d5d84fd9455fc68 OP_EQUAL
address
3JdxY2pkgZBTw7HGpVdWLnhgwDjaU4ef6n
transaction
e24ca68d08d1d02dc3120d31f24cbdb59eb0b1f6357434dd7539f3aed906e9e4
spent
false

9 Sat Ranges